Whether you are starting your journey in the pharmaceutical, medical devices, food industries or other sectors with regulatory needs, Humber’s Regulatory Affairs graduate certificate program is designed to equip you with the skills for success. This program focuses on making regulatory affairs concepts accessible and applicable. You will uncover the regulatory system, legislation, procedures and practices relevant to developing, producing and marketing health-related and consumable products. |
